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Andreas Pakulat
On 26.06.06 20:22:10, Marco Estrada Martinez wrote:
> Andreas Pakulat schrieb:
> >ob der Eintrag von update-grub generiert wird oder von dir angelegt
> >wurde.
> 
> von update-grub. Kernel mit make-kpkg erstellt und dann mit dpkg installiert

Wie gesagt dann koenntest du die altoptions Variante nutzen.

> Hab mich wohl für init 4 entscheiden und mit update-rc.d alle Scripte des 
> Runlevels entfernen und dann nur ein script reinpacken das mir mit xinit -e 
> tvtime -m mein tv-Programm starten. Sollte doch so gehen.

Jupp.

> Also werde ich den Eintrag des aktuellen Kernels kopieren und an den neuen 
> Eintrag rc 4 in die kernel-zeile anhängen, oder?

Nein, nur die 4. Und achte darauf den Eintrag ganz ans Ende der menu.lst
anzuhaengen und nicht in den Bereich den update-grub veraendert.

Andreas

-- 
You worry too much about your job.  Stop it.  You are not paid enough to worry.


-- 
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/

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Marco Estrada Martinez

Andreas Pakulat schrieb:

ob der Eintrag von update-grub generiert wird oder von dir angelegt
wurde.


von update-grub. Kernel mit make-kpkg erstellt und dann mit dpkg installiert


einfach die TV-Module in
/etc/modules eintragen und die alternativ-Option zum normalen Kernel
booten.


sind fest im Kernel drin



Wieso nicht? Dafuer sind sie da. Zumal sowieso nur 0, 1 und 6 spezielle
Bedeutungen haben. Alle anderen Runlevel koennen frei von dir verwendet
werden. Jedenfalls bei Debian.

  


Hab mich wohl für init 4 entscheiden und mit update-rc.d alle Scripte 
des Runlevels entfernen und dann nur ein script reinpacken das mir mit 
xinit -e tvtime -m mein tv-Programm starten. Sollte doch so gehen.


Also werde ich den Eintrag des aktuellen Kernels kopieren und an den 
neuen Eintrag rc 4 in die kernel-zeile anhängen, oder? Denke ich nun 
ganz falsch?


THX
Marco


--
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/


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Marco Estrada Martinez

Moritz Lenz schrieb:

Ich weiss nicht, ob das geht, aber brauchst du denn alle 0-6,S Runlevel?


Nein, natürlich nicht werde mich wohl für init 4 entscheiden und mit 
update-rc.d alle Scripte des Runlevels entfernen und dann nur ein script 
reinpacken das mir mit xinit -e tvtime -m mein tv-Programm starten. 
Sollte doch so gehen


THX
Marco


--
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/


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Andreas Pakulat
On 26.06.06 19:50:12, Marco Estrada Martinez wrote:
> Andreas Pakulat schrieb:
> >
> >Jaein, wenn das einer von den generierten Eintraegen ist, benutze:
> >
> Nein würde ja dafür einen eigenen Kernel bauen der nur die nötigsten sachen 
> mitbringt.

Es geht nicht um eigenen Kernel oder nicht eigenen Kernel. Die Frage
ist, ob der Eintrag von update-grub generiert wird oder von dir angelegt
wurde. Auch selbst-gebaute Kernel (mit und ohne make-kpkg) koennen von
update-grub erkannt und automatisch in die menu.lst eingebunden werden.
Fuer diese kann man dann eben mittels altoptions eine alternativ-Zeile
mitgenerieren lassen. 

Da ja wie schon erwaehnt das Modul-Laden kaum Zeit benoetigt brauchst du
auch nicht unbedingt nen eigenen Kernel, einfach die TV-Module in
/etc/modules eintragen und die alternativ-Option zum normalen Kernel
booten.

> >Nein, benutze eine der Zahlen von 2-5 und aendere mittels update-rc.d
> >die Symlinks fuer den Runlevel den du gewaehlt hast. man update-rc.d
> >sagt dir wie.
> >
> 
> Naja wollte nicht unbedingt ein vorhandenes Runlevel nutzen ein eigenes wäre 
> mir lieber.

Wieso nicht? Dafuer sind sie da. Zumal sowieso nur 0, 1 und 6 spezielle
Bedeutungen haben. Alle anderen Runlevel koennen frei von dir verwendet
werden. Jedenfalls bei Debian.

Andreas

-- 
You will meet an important person who will help you advance professionally.


-- 
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/

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Moritz Lenz
Marco Estrada Martinez wrote:
> Andreas Pakulat schrieb:
>> Und dann noch einen Eintrag im Bootloader der statt rc 2 den anderen
>> startet (einfach die Nummer an die Boot-Zeile dranhaengen).
> 
> Danke, aber leider finde ich keinen Eintrag in meiner bootloader-Datei
> (grub)
[...]
> Einfach an die kernel Zeile anhängen? 

Ja.

> Kann ich da eine Zahl ungleich 0-6
> anlegen und dann den entsprechenden /etc/rcx.d-Ordner nutzen und anlegen?

Ich weiss nicht, ob das geht, aber brauchst du denn alle 0-6,S Runlevel?

Grüße,
Moritz

-- 
Moritz Lenz
http://moritz.faui2k3.org/



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den klaus zerwes

Marco Estrada Martinez schrieb:

Hi @all,

ich habe ein debian laufen. Es ist meine Server-Kiste. An dieser ist 
auch eine TV-Karte eingebaut (Terratec Cinergy 400) geht einwandfrei.


Nun war meine Idee:

Da beim normalen starten des Rechners alle Dienste (WWW, Mail, Proxy 
...) automatisch gestartet werden dauert es etwas ;o). Muss leider den 
Rechner jeden Tag aufs neue booten. sonst steigt mir meine Frau aufs 
Haus -> Stromkosten ;o(. Alo muss ich wenn ich vorher 100%ig weiss das 
ich nur fernsehn möchte werden alle Dienste logischerweise gestartet. 
Ist es möglich einen Kernel zu bauen der nur TV-Karte, Sound, 
IDE-Treiber, ein wenig Grafik, also nur das aller notigste um die 
TV-Karte zum laufen zu bekommen. Und weiter das beim starten nicht alle 
Scripte in /etc/rc2.d ausgeführt werden. Eigentlich würde ein xinit -e 
tvtime reichen.


Also das beim anschalten (bei nur TV) ganz schnell geht.


Deine Startscripte haben mit dem Kernel herzlich wenig zu tun.
man init

wie wäre es mit der Konfiguration:
init 3: normaler Betrieb
init 5: nut TV

man update-rc.d


Über andere Ansätze wäre ich sehr dankbar.

Vielen Dank für Eure Gedanken. Deutschland wird WM-Meister ;o)


Ich entblöde mich jetzt nicht so weit hierauf ne Antwort in blau-eweiß 
zu geben.

Aber ich finde das mit dem Papst reicht für dieses Jahrzehnt.


THX
Marco


Klaus

--
Klaus Zerwes
http://www.zero-sys.net


--
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/


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Marco Estrada Martinez

Andreas Pakulat schrieb:


Jaein, wenn das einer von den generierten Eintraegen ist, benutze:


  
Nein würde ja dafür einen eigenen Kernel bauen der nur die nötigsten 
sachen mitbringt.

Nein, benutze eine der Zahlen von 2-5 und aendere mittels update-rc.d
die Symlinks fuer den Runlevel den du gewaehlt hast. man update-rc.d
sagt dir wie.

  


Naja wollte nicht unbedingt ein vorhandenes Runlevel nutzen ein eigenes 
wäre mir lieber.


Danke vielmals

Marco


--
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/


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Andreas Pakulat
On 26.06.06 19:20:00, Marco Estrada Martinez wrote:
> Andreas Pakulat schrieb:
> >Und dann noch einen Eintrag im Bootloader der statt rc 2 den anderen
> >startet (einfach die Nummer an die Boot-Zeile dranhaengen).
> 
> Danke, aber leider finde ich keinen Eintrag in meiner bootloader-Datei (grub)
> 
> -- schnipp /boot/grub/menu.lst
> 
> title   Debian GNU/Linux, kernel 2.6.17.1-trinity
> root(hd0,0)
> kernel  /vmlinuz-2.6.17.1-trinity root=/dev/hda3 ro 
> video=sisfb:mode:1280x800x16,mem:32768,rate:60 resume=/dev/hda2 hdc=ide-cd 
> ec_burst=1 acpi_sleep=s3_bios,s3_mode
> # init=/sbin/bootchartd # für visuelles bootimage
> initrd  /initrd.img-2.6.17.1-trinity
> savedefault
> boot
> 
> --schnapp
> 
> Einfach an die kernel Zeile anhängen?

Jaein, wenn das einer von den generierten Eintraegen ist, benutze:

## should update-grub create alternative automagic boot options
## e.g. alternative=true
##  alternative=false
# alternative=true

## altoption boot targets option
## multiple altoptions lines are allowed
## e.g. altoptions=(extra menu suffix) extra boot options
##  altoptions=(single-user) single
# altoptions=(miniboot) 3
# altoptions=(recovery mode) single

Wobei der 2. altoptions Eintrag dafuer sorgt das darueber Runlevel 3
gebootet wird.

Und wenn der Eintrag von dir ist: Ja, einfach die Zahl dranhaengen.

> Kann ich da eine Zahl ungleich 0-6 
> anlegen und dann den entsprechenden /etc/rcx.d-Ordner nutzen und anlegen?

Nein, benutze eine der Zahlen von 2-5 und aendere mittels update-rc.d
die Symlinks fuer den Runlevel den du gewaehlt hast. man update-rc.d
sagt dir wie.

Andreas

-- 
You are a fluke of the universe; you have no right to be here.


-- 
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/

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Marco Estrada Martinez

Andreas Pakulat schrieb:

Und dann noch einen Eintrag im Bootloader der statt rc 2 den anderen
startet (einfach die Nummer an die Boot-Zeile dranhaengen).


Danke, aber leider finde ich keinen Eintrag in meiner bootloader-Datei 
(grub)


-- schnipp /boot/grub/menu.lst

title   Debian GNU/Linux, kernel 2.6.17.1-trinity
root(hd0,0)
kernel  /vmlinuz-2.6.17.1-trinity root=/dev/hda3 ro 
video=sisfb:mode:1280x800x16,mem:32768,rate:60 resume=/dev/hda2 
hdc=ide-cd ec_burst=1 acpi_sleep=s3_bios,s3_mode

# init=/sbin/bootchartd # für visuelles bootimage
initrd  /initrd.img-2.6.17.1-trinity
savedefault
boot

--schnapp

Einfach an die kernel Zeile anhängen? Kann ich da eine Zahl ungleich 0-6 
anlegen und dann den entsprechenden /etc/rcx.d-Ordner nutzen und anlegen?


THX
Marco


--
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/


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Andreas Pakulat
On 26.06.06 18:54:55, Moritz Lenz wrote:
> Marco Estrada Martinez wrote:
> > Und weiter das beim starten nicht alle
> > Scripte in /etc/rc2.d ausgeführt werden. Eigentlich würde ein xinit -e
> > tvtime reichen.
> 
> Du könntest dir zum TV gucken ein eigenens runlevel aussuchen, in dem
> dann die ganzen nicht benutzten Dämonen nicht gestartet werden.

Und dann noch einen Eintrag im Bootloader der statt rc 2 den anderen
startet (einfach die Nummer an die Boot-Zeile dranhaengen).

Andreas
 
-- 
You feel a whole lot more like you do now than you did when you used to.


-- 
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/

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Marco Estrada Martinez

Moritz Lenz schrieb:

Das Laden der Module geht sehr schnell. Was viel Zeit braucht sind die
Init-Scripte und die Hardwareerkennung.
  

Naja bis ich mich anmeldenkann ca. 50-60 sek.)

Du könntest dir zum TV gucken ein eigenens runlevel aussuchen, in dem
dann die ganzen nicht benutzten Dämonen nicht gestartet werden.
  

Mh. das wäre ja was, aber wie?

Sprach- und inhaltliche Verwirrung kombiniert ;)
[ganz OT: den Frauen trau ich das bei der nächsten WM auch wieder zu ;)]
  

Aber naklar ...

Danke
Gruß Marco


--
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/


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)



Re: k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Moritz Lenz
Hallo,

Marco Estrada Martinez wrote:
> Da beim normalen starten des Rechners alle Dienste (WWW, Mail, Proxy
> ...) automatisch gestartet werden dauert es etwas ;o). Muss leider den
> Rechner jeden Tag aufs neue booten. sonst steigt mir meine Frau aufs
> Haus -> Stromkosten ;o(. Alo muss ich wenn ich vorher 100%ig weiss das
> ich nur fernsehn möchte werden alle Dienste logischerweise gestartet.
> Ist es möglich einen Kernel zu bauen der nur TV-Karte, Sound,
> IDE-Treiber, ein wenig Grafik, also nur das aller notigste um die
> TV-Karte zum laufen zu bekommen.

Das Laden der Module geht sehr schnell. Was viel Zeit braucht sind die
Init-Scripte und die Hardwareerkennung.

> Und weiter das beim starten nicht alle
> Scripte in /etc/rc2.d ausgeführt werden. Eigentlich würde ein xinit -e
> tvtime reichen.

Du könntest dir zum TV gucken ein eigenens runlevel aussuchen, in dem
dann die ganzen nicht benutzten Dämonen nicht gestartet werden.


> Vielen Dank für Eure Gedanken. Deutschland wird WM-Meister ;o)

Sprach- und inhaltliche Verwirrung kombiniert ;)
[ganz OT: den Frauen trau ich das bei der nächsten WM auch wieder zu ;)]

Grüße,
Moritz

-- 
Moritz Lenz
http://moritz.faui2k3.org/



signature.asc
Description: OpenPGP digital signature


kernel + extra /etc/rc2.d

2006-06-26 Diskussionsfäden Marco Estrada Martinez

Hi @all,

ich habe ein debian laufen. Es ist meine Server-Kiste. An dieser ist 
auch eine TV-Karte eingebaut (Terratec Cinergy 400) geht einwandfrei.


Nun war meine Idee:

Da beim normalen starten des Rechners alle Dienste (WWW, Mail, Proxy 
...) automatisch gestartet werden dauert es etwas ;o). Muss leider den 
Rechner jeden Tag aufs neue booten. sonst steigt mir meine Frau aufs 
Haus -> Stromkosten ;o(. Alo muss ich wenn ich vorher 100%ig weiss das 
ich nur fernsehn möchte werden alle Dienste logischerweise gestartet. 
Ist es möglich einen Kernel zu bauen der nur TV-Karte, Sound, 
IDE-Treiber, ein wenig Grafik, also nur das aller notigste um die 
TV-Karte zum laufen zu bekommen. Und weiter das beim starten nicht alle 
Scripte in /etc/rc2.d ausgeführt werden. Eigentlich würde ein xinit -e 
tvtime reichen.


Also das beim anschalten (bei nur TV) ganz schnell geht.

Über andere Ansätze wäre ich sehr dankbar.

Vielen Dank für Eure Gedanken. Deutschland wird WM-Meister ;o)

THX
Marco


--
Haeufig gestellte Fragen und Antworten (FAQ): 
http://www.de.debian.org/debian-user-german-FAQ/


Zum AUSTRAGEN schicken Sie eine Mail an [EMAIL PROTECTED]
mit dem Subject "unsubscribe". Probleme? Mail an [EMAIL PROTECTED] (engl)